The Miami Antique Jewelry & Watch Show will be held at the Miami Airport Convention Center from Nov. 14 to 16, 2014.

Starting in 2014, the Miami Beach Antique Jewelry & Watch Show will be held in Miami, a move that allows the event to coincide with the International Watch & Jewelry Guild’s (IWJG) trade show.

Held at the Miami Airport Convention Center, the show will now be known as the Miami Antique Jewelry & Watch Show. Next year, it runs from Nov. 14 to 16.

“By moving this show to Miami, we’re able to respond to requests from our dealers and attendees by hosting this show in November versus earlier date patterns in September and October,” said Dan Darby, group show director for U.S. Antique Shows and vice-president of George Little Management (GLM).

“The Miami Airport Convention Center already hosts our Miami National Antique Show and was uniquely able to fulfil this request for us.”

The Miami Airport Convention Center has 172,000 sf of meeting and exhibition space, allowing for a projected 20 per cent increase in exhibitors.

“This is a winning situation for everyone,” said Joe Nelson, executive director of the International Watch & Jewelry Guild.

“The IWJG members and the Miami Antique Jewelry & Watch Show dealers have an opportunity to experience these two great shows on one business trip. We’re excited!”
